Lakers drop 5-0 decision to nationally-ranked Hamilton

The Oswego State women's soccer team suffered its second straight shutout loss of the season in a 5-0 setback to host Hamilton College on Saturday, September 13 in Clinton, NY.

The Continentals (4-0), ranked 24th among NCAA Division III teams in the latest rankings conducted by the National Soccer Coaches Association of America (NSCAA), extended their unbeaten streak to 19 games and are 18-0-1 in their last 19 games at home.

Hamilton, who outshot the Lakers (2-2), 30-6, and held an 8-3 edge in corner kicks, scored twice in the first half, including the game's opening goal at the 9:30 mark and tacked on three goals in the second half to put the game out of reach.

Sophomore goalie Toby Klein (Westbury/W.T. Clarke) faced 16 shots and made 12 saves in 75:40 played for Oswego.  Sophomore Lauren Harsma (Syracuse/West Genesee) came in to play the final 14:20, yielding the game's final goal and making a save.

The Lakers are Idle until Saturday, Sept. 20, when they return to Laker Field to face defending SUNYAC champion Oneonta State in a 1:00 p.m. contest.
